Si %T BIMBINGAN MINAT DAN BAKAT UNTUK MENGEMBANGKAN POTENSI DIRI SISWA SMK KEMENADI KOMPLEKS KEBAJIKAN ANAK-ANAK YATIM BINTULU SARAWAK MALAYSIA %X This study aims to describe the implementation of the student interest and talent guidance program at the Bintulu Orphanage Community Welfare Complex using Prayitno's guidance theory approach. This study uses a descriptive qualitative method with data collection techniques through observation, in-depth interviews, and Focus Group Discussions (FGD) involving students, guidance teachers, and the complex management. The results of the study indicate that the interest and talent guidance program has been implemented in stages and consistently in accordance with the stages set out in the theory, the needs identification stage, the diagnosis and analysis stage, the service or intervention stage, and the evaluation and follow-up stage. Although the guidance implementers do not come from a background as Guidance and Counseling (BK) teachers, the approach applied remains effective in identifying and developing student potential. Program evaluation is carried out simply through direct observation, activity reports, and teacher diaries. This program has been proven to have a positive impact on the development of skills, morals, and student achievement. Students also showed behavioral changes and improved enthusiasm for learning as a result of the guidance they received %K Bimbingan Minat, Bakat, Potensi Diri Siswa %D 2025 %I UIN SUNAN KALIJAGA YOGYAKARTA %L digilib71417
